在体感AR技术逐步渗透到游戏、教育、零售等多个领域的今天,部署包的管理已不再是简单的文件打包问题,而是直接影响用户体验与产品迭代效率的关键环节。尤其对于体感AR这类依赖实时交互与高精度感知的应用,部署包的体积、加载速度和更新机制直接决定了用户能否顺畅进入场景、完成动作捕捉并获得沉浸式反馈。当前不少体感AR项目在实际落地中面临部署包过大导致启动缓慢、更新频繁却耗时过长、跨设备兼容性差等问题,严重制约了应用的推广与用户留存。因此,如何通过科学的部署包设计实现高效落地与快速迭代,已成为开发者必须面对的核心挑战。
理解部署包的本质:从静态资源到动态生态
体感AR系统的部署包不仅是代码与资源的集合,更是一个承载功能模块、交互逻辑与环境配置的动态载体。它需要在保证核心功能完整性的前提下,兼顾不同终端的性能差异与网络条件。传统的一体化打包方式虽简单,但随着体感AR功能复杂度提升,整个包体积动辄数GB,不仅延长了首次安装时间,也限制了后续更新的灵活性。尤其是在移动设备或低配硬件上运行时,过大的部署包容易引发内存溢出、卡顿甚至崩溃,严重影响体感追踪的精准度与响应速度。因此,重新审视部署包的设计理念,转向以“按需加载”为核心的架构,成为优化路径的起点。
模块化打包:让体感AR应用更轻盈灵活
针对部署包体积过大这一痛点,模块化打包策略应运而生。通过将体感AR应用的功能拆分为独立的模块——如基础渲染引擎、动作识别算法、语音交互组件、场景切换管理等——开发者可根据用户使用场景动态组合所需模块。例如,在教育类体感AR应用中,仅需加载“人体骨骼追踪”与“教学动画播放”模块;而在零售场景下的虚拟试衣功能,则可优先加载“3D建模渲染”与“服饰材质映射”模块。这种按需加载的方式显著减少了初始下载量,同时支持后期功能的渐进式引入,极大提升了部署效率与用户体验。

此外,模块化设计还为版本管理和灰度发布提供了便利。当某个模块出现兼容性问题或性能瓶颈时,无需整体回滚,只需替换特定模块即可完成修复,大幅降低故障影响范围。对于持续迭代的体感AR产品而言,这不仅缩短了上线周期,也增强了系统稳定性。
增量更新机制:让每一次升级都快如闪电
在体感AR应用频繁迭代的背景下,全量更新已难以为继。用户对即时体验的要求越来越高,一次长达几分钟的更新过程极易导致流失。为此,引入增量更新机制成为必然选择。该机制基于版本对比分析,仅传输前后版本之间的差异文件,使更新包体积可缩小至原包的5%~10%。结合智能压缩算法与分块传输技术,即使在网络条件较差的环境下,也能实现秒级更新。
更重要的是,增量更新支持断点续传与后台静默更新,用户在使用过程中几乎无感知。例如,当体感AR游戏推出新关卡或优化动作识别模型时,系统可在后台自动下载更新包,并在下次启动时无缝集成,确保用户始终处于最新版本状态。这种“无感升级”的体验,正是现代体感AR应用赢得用户青睐的关键。
智能资源预加载:提前布局,保障流畅体验
体感AR的核心价值在于实时性与沉浸感,任何延迟都会破坏交互节奏。为应对这一挑战,智能资源预加载机制被广泛采用。系统通过分析用户行为路径与场景切换规律,提前预测下一步可能用到的资源,并在空闲时段进行预加载。例如,在体感AR健身应用中,系统可预判用户即将进入“瑜伽拉伸”模式,提前加载对应动作库与音效资源,避免在关键时刻因资源未就绪而卡顿。
结合边缘计算与CDN加速技术,预加载资源可分布于离用户最近的节点,进一步减少延迟。同时,通过缓存策略合理管理本地存储空间,防止过度占用设备内存。这一系列优化共同构建了一个“快而不乱”的运行环境,真正实现了体感AR从“能用”到“好用”的跨越。
面向未来:部署包优化带来的长期价值
从长远来看,一套高效的部署包管理体系不仅能解决当下痛点,更将为体感AR技术的大规模商业化落地奠定坚实基础。一方面,它显著降低了运维成本——通过模块化与增量更新,减少了服务器带宽压力与人工干预频率;另一方面,它有效提升了用户留存率与活跃度,因为流畅稳定的体验是用户持续使用的根本动力。对于企业而言,这意味着更高的转化率与更低的获客成本。
无论是教育机构希望快速部署体感AR互动课件,还是零售品牌亟需上线虚拟试穿功能,一个优化良好的部署包体系都能让技术落地更快、更稳、更省心。随着体感AR应用场景不断拓展,部署包管理正从幕后走向台前,成为决定成败的重要一环。
我们专注于体感AR相关技术的研发与落地服务,提供从模块化部署包设计、增量更新方案实施到智能预加载策略定制的一站式解决方案,助力企业实现体感AR应用的高效迭代与稳定运行,开发中17723342546


